Moon urges parliament to review US$3.6 bil. supplementary budget ahead of one year anniv. in office
  • 6 years ago
Don't rest on your laurels and time is of the essence.
These are the two key messages President Moon Jae-in had for his government and the country's politicians as his administration nears the first full year in office on Tuesday.
The president began his weekly Cabinet meeting by complimenting his cabinet members for a year well done and encouraging them to keep up the good work.
President Moon then went on to urge parliament to swiftly review the government's supplementary budget proposal submitted to the National Assembly over a month ago.

"Time is of the essence for budget supplements. That's because we can achieve the goal of the supplementary budget only when we implement it on time."

He explained that the 3-point-6 billion U.S. dollar extra budget is aimed at realizing the minimum number of government projects that are critical to creating new jobs for the youth and to help sectors suffering from prolonged slumps such as shipbuilding and automobiles.
